What is the impact of gas pressure on appliance performance?

  1. Incorrect pressure can lead to inefficient operation or damage to the appliance

  2. Higher pressure always increases efficiency

  3. Gas pressure does not affect appliance safety

  4. Lower pressure leads to faster combustion

The correct answer is: Incorrect pressure can lead to inefficient operation or damage to the appliance

Gas pressure significantly influences how appliances function, as it directly affects the combustion process. When appliances operate at incorrect pressure levels, it can result in a variety of issues, such as inefficient fuel usage, improper combustion, and potential damage to internal components. For example, if the pressure is too low, the appliance may not receive enough gas to operate effectively, leading to incomplete combustion which can produce harmful byproducts like carbon monoxide. Conversely, excessively high gas pressure can cause the appliance to burn gas too quickly, potentially leading to overheating and damage. Maintaining the appropriate gas pressure is crucial for the safe and efficient operation of gas appliances. It ensures that devices are not only functioning optimally but also minimizes the risk of safety hazards.
